How fast is DSL internet in 60008?
The map below shows maximum DSL internet speeds by area in 60008.

DSL Internet Speed Key
The average 60008 home can get up to 81 Mbps on their DSL internet plan. The fastest DSL download speed in the zip is 100 Mbps, which 54.98% of residents can get. Some homes and apartments do not have access to these speeds. On the slower end, for example, 8.01% of homes can only purchase plans up to 10 Mbps. Is DSL the fastest internet I can get in 60008?
The fastest internet for you may vary based on where in 60008 you live. In general, cable competes most often with DSL in the zip.
- Fiber is the fastest internet type for 19.83% of 60008 homes.
- Cable is fastest for 80.05% of the zip.
- DSL is fastest for less than 1%.
- Fixed wireless is fastest for less than 1%.
- Satellite internet may be the only option for less than 1% of 60008 homes.
